BCCI Hands Strict Deadline To Mohammed Shami, Gives Him Huge Condition For Return To Team India
Mohammed Shami has less than a week in hand to convince selectors to pick him for the Border-Gavaskar Trophy, as per a report. Shami, who has only recently returned to competitive cricket following a lengthy spell on the sidelines due to injury, is reportedly being heavily monitored by the Board of Control for Cricket in India's (BCCI) medical team. Following an impressive showing in his first Ranji Trophy match back for Bengal, Shami will be evaluated on a few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y (SMAT) T20 games. It is also reported that a big requirement for Shami is to lose some weight and regain fitness.
